July 5 - 6 is World Firefly Day! Like a lot of insects fireflies are threatened by our actions. Check out fireflyersinternational.net to find out how you can help gather data on these magical animals and help scientists track their populations.

My #linocut print shows 3 fireflies (Photinus pyralis, the common eastern firefly or big dipper firefly) in a field against the night sky. These bioluminescent insects are the most common firefly in North American, and 🧡1/2

I love how this queen Lasius arizonicus ant is smooth like glass. She’s a social parasite who , after dropping her wings, sneaks into existing ant colonies, kills the resident queen, and takes over.

So much drama. #Lasius #Ants #Insects
